A new disturbing detail has been revealed about the life of convicted murderer Bryan Kohberger, the man who took the lives of four University of Idaho students in 2022. Forensics company Cellebrite were given the responsibility of looking at Kohberger's phone and laptop to search for evidence connecting him to the murders he is now serving life in prison for.
